WebApr 10, 2024 · Prepared feeds for carnivorous fish usually contain less than 20 percent soluble carbohydrate, while feeds for omnivorous species usually contain 25 to 45 percent. In addition to being a source of energy, soluble carbohydrate in fish feed also gives pellets integrity and stability and makes them less dense. Webone-eighth of 1 cup. WebPangasianodon hypophthalamus, Commonly known as Pangas, is a highly migratory riverine fish species. It lives in estuaries and large rivers. It inhabits mainly in floodplains and channels of large rivers and seasonally moves up to floodplains and marshy land for feeding and nursing. The species contains high nutritional value.
